The goal of this new one-year program is to gather a group of between 8-12 people every fall to be in a peer cohort that will meet together once each week over the course of a year in addition an overnight retreat. The Leadership Beargrass experience will equip participants with:

• an understanding of biblical leadership and the role of a servant/leader,
• an inventory of personal spiritual gifts and types,
• a nurturing routine of spiritual practice,
• experience in discerning God’s call for oneself and one’s congregation,
• and the development of a personal plan for ministry in the church.

This nine-month program will meet on Wednesday evenings from September through May and will be led by Merillat Flowers and Dr. Gary Straub. Merillat is an alumnus of the “Leadership Woodmont” class in our previous congregation and has led leadership programs for hundreds of community leaders in various cities around the country. Gary is a Disciples minister who has spent years coaching clergy and lay leaders and has written several leadership books about developing church leaders. Together, they have spent over a year planning and developing this program and will co-facilitate the sessions with this first cohort each week.
